Assembles 39 short pieces on the physical world, law and property, the Green critique, and accommodating the future. Among the authorities represented are Genesis, Aristotle, Frank Waters, John Locke, Karl Marx, Henry David Thoreau, Rachel Carson, Paul Ehrlich, Barry Commoner, and Murray Bookchin.
